Discussion, implications, and limitations
The discussion of results begins with observations about patterns in the research data.
The data shown in Table I on the relative importance of clothing web site attributes and
on perceived attributes of favorite clothing web sites suggest attributes that clothing
retailers’ web sites should possess to attract college students. The respondents in this
study put relatively high importance on such attributes as the following: easy
navigability and payment; provision of color, size, price, and other product information;
allowance for order tracking and return of unwanted items; and security of credit-card
numbers and personal information. As seen in Table I, the mean values for the responses
on relative importance of clothing web site attributes generally track with those for
perceived attributes of favorite clothing web sites: Respondents tended to rate their
favorite web sites most (least) highly in the attributes they considered most (least)
important. The consistency between these two sets of ratings has the unsurprising
implication that college students tend to favor clothing web sites perceived to have
attributes they consider important, and it also lends support to types of attributes that
retailers should incorporate in their web sites. An attribute that departs from the pattern
just noted is “fun to visit.” Our respondents seemed to put little importance on web sites
being fun, but rated their favorite web sites rather high in this regard. Also worth noting
is that the respondents neither valued the offering of many different brands in a web site
nor viewed their favorite web sites as flush in brand variety; however, they rated the
favorite web sites rather high in carrying their preferred brands. The success of a
clothing web site aimed at college students may depend more on carrying select brands
that appeal to this market segment than on carrying a large selection of brands. A
retailer would, of course, need to conduct market research to learn the preferred brands
and effective means for promoting them.
